2015-06-23 2 views
0

Как я могу скопировать BufferedReader в BufferedWriter для файлов pdf в android?Как скопировать bufferedreader в bufferedwriter для файлов PDF в android

Проблема в том, что я хочу скопировать файл с помощью gms-библиотеки (я не могу загрузить с помощью gms, просто скопируйте), поэтому, если я прочитаю каждую строку с BufferedReader, как я могу копировать с BufferedWriter и сохранять pdf-файлы? Каждая идея оценивается. Спасибо

+0

Мне нужно скопировать файлы PDF (двоичные файлы) читать и писать ... но я не знаю, как –

ответ

1

Вы не можете. Readers и Writers предназначены для символьных данных. Файлы PDF являются двоичными. Вы должны использовать InputStreams и OutputStreams.

+0

спасибо, у вас есть пример, пожалуйста? –

+1

Да, вы поочередно вызываете 'read()' и 'write()' в цикле, пока не столкнетесь с концом потока. Необходимый код тривиален и был отправлен здесь сотни раз. Мной. – EJP

+0

Что делать, если некоторые символы написаны неправильно, как проверить кодировку? –

Смежные вопросы